Acerbis

Acerbis X-Force Handguard - Blue 2170320003

(No reviews yet) Write a Review
SKU:
acb2170320003
UPC:
886687806506
MPN:
2170320003
Condition:
New
MSRP: $46.42
$40.36
— You save $6.06
Frequently bought together: